#17302F Color

#17302F is rgb(23, 48, 47) in RGB, hsl(178, 35%, 14%) in HSL, and about cmyk(52%, 0%, 2%, 81%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Medium Jungle Green (#1C352D),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 5.12.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

What #17302F Is Called

Most hex codes have no name: there are 16.7 million of them and a few thousand registered names. These are the named colors nearest to #17302F, ordered by CIE76 distance in CIELAB. Anything under about ΔE 2 is a difference most people cannot see.

Text Contrast & Accessibility

W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#17302F background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#17302F Frequently Asked Questions

What color is #17302F?

#17302F is a darkest teal — rgb(23, 48, 47) in RGB and hsl(178, 35%, 14%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Medium Jungle Green (#1C352D),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 5.12.

What is the RGB value of #17302F?

#17302F is rgb(23, 48, 47) — red 23, green 48, and blue 47 on the 0-255 scale.

What is the CMYK value of #17302F?

#17302F converts to approximately cmyk(52%, 0%, 2%, 81%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.

Should text on #17302F be black or white?

White text is the more readable choice. #17302F scores 14:1 against white and 1.5: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.

Can I write #17302F as a CSS color keyword?

No. #17302F is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kslategray (#2F4F4F) at a CIE76 distance of 13.51, which is visibly different.
